Buying Guide

Pastel type matters

Oil pastels stay tackier and resist smudging differently than soft pastels; choose oil pastels for bold opaque marks and soft pastels for easy blending and gradients

Color range for stenciling

Larger color sets give more hue options for layered stencils—120-color sets provide finer color matching than small neon packs

Neon and specialty colors

Neon oil pastels are useful for high-visibility accents and modern decor accents but may have different opacity and mixing behavior than standard pigments

Packaging and storage

Wooden boxes or organized cases help keep many colors accessible and protected, reducing breakage and making stencil workflows faster

Beginner-friendly features

Look for sets labeled beginner-friendly with consistent texture and clear color labeling to simplify learning layering and edge control with stencils
